BP has asked a Texas judge to dismiss a lawsuit filed by some institutional investors, claiming the UK High Court should hear the case.
Investors are suing BP's board and management, claiming that their relentless pursuit of cost-cutting came at the expense of safety measures that could have prevented the Deepwater Horizon oil spill that brought the company to its knees last year.
